Chart_Builder_Functions D

Total Complexity 1,012
Dependencies 3
Dependents 1
Total lines 1,681
Lines of code 931
Logical lines of code 681
Comment lines 406
Methods 18
Properties 2

Methods 18

Method Rating Maintainability Complexity Lines of code
get_chart_settings_google_admin()
D
0
423 380
get_chart_settings_google_public()
D
0
355 187
get_chart_settings_chartjs_admin()
D
23
95 89
get_chart_settings_chartjs_public()
D
31 91 48
get_db_table_columns()
A
50 9 25
get_quiz_query()
A
45 8 39
get_table_html()
S
50 6 36
get_db_tables()
S
57 5 16
get_table_columns()
S
58 4 16
get_post_type_properties()
S
50 3 30
versionCompare()
S
62 3 11
get_db_table_mapping()
S
58 2 16
get_all_db_tables_column_mapping()
S
64 2 10
validateDate()
S
74 2 4
getAllowedTypes()
S
66 1 10
get_instance()
S
80 1 3
get_all_charts_count()
S
68 1 6
__construct()
S
73 1 5